How Vicky Bliss Began

Elizabeth Peters, a Ph.D. in Egyptology, channeled her passion for history and storytelling into the Vicky Bliss series, starting with Borrower of the Night in 1973. Inspired by her academic background and love for adventure, Peters crafted Vicky as a bold, brainy heroine—a refreshing departure from typical mystery protagonists. Set against the backdrop of late 20th-century Europe and Egypt, the series reflects Peters’ knack for weaving historical detail into fast-paced plots.

Peters, also known for her Amelia Peabody series, wrote Vicky Bliss over four decades, with the final book, The Laughter of Dead Kings, published in 2008. Her goal? To create a heroine who was as intellectually formidable as she was charming, navigating a male-dominated field with confidence and humor.

The Heart of Vicky Bliss

The Vicky Bliss series kicks off with Borrower of the Night, where Vicky hunts a missing 16th-century wooden masterpiece in a eerie German castle. In Street of the Five Moons, she chases the creator of a Charlemagne talisman replica to Rome, unraveling a web of deceit. Trojan Gold sees her tracking a lost treasure linked to WWII, while Night Train to Memphis plunges her into Egypt’s archaeological underworld to foil a heist.

Themes of courage, curiosity, and romance shine throughout. Vicky’s expertise in medieval art grounds the series in rich historical context, while her impulsive nature—often sparked by her insatiable curiosity—leads to thrilling predicaments. Her evolving relationship with Sir John Smythe, a charismatic art thief, adds a slow-burn romance that keeps readers hooked. Peters’ witty prose and vivid settings, from Munich’s museums to Egypt’s deserts, make each book a vibrant escape.

The series’ blend of mystery, historical intrigue, and humor sets it apart. Unlike fantasy-heavy novels, Vicky’s adventures are grounded in real-world history, offering a refreshing mix of education and entertainment. Fans praise Peters’ ability to balance intellectual depth with lighthearted fun, making the series a cozy yet exhilarating read.

Why Vicky Bliss Resonates

The Vicky Bliss series has carved a niche among mystery and historical fiction fans, thanks to its smart, spirited heroine and Peters’ masterful storytelling. Vicky’s feminist outlook and unapologetic confidence resonate with readers seeking strong female leads. The series’ blend of art history and adventure appeals to those who love Indiana Jones-style tales with a scholarly twist.

Though less famous than Peters’ Amelia Peabody series, Vicky Bliss has a devoted fanbase, with books like Trojan Gold earning nominations for awards like the Anthony Award. Its enduring appeal lies in its timeless themes—love, bravery, and the thrill of discovery—making it a hidden gem for new readers to uncover.
